- Roots Style Supercharger Compressor
- 6 psi of Boost
- PCM Recalibration
- Cast Aluminium Intake Manifold
- Roush Air Inlet Tube
- High Flow Air Filter
- Upper Radiator Hose
- Throttle Body Spacer
- S/C Drive Pulley, Crank Pulley, and Idler Pullies
- FEAD Serpentine Belt System; Second 8-Rib Belt
- Kit contains all necessary Brackets, Hardware, Gaskets, and Instructions
- Fits 2wd and 4wd applications
- HP Gain 112HP 137lbs Torque
- E.O. # D-418-3
- $5,199.00 to $7,869.44 depends on where you buy it from

One problem with the Roush blower's are that they are a roots blower and not a twin screw and has a shorter power band than a twin screw.
